python中列表添加的四种方法小结
作者:ly_qiu 时间:2023-12-10 21:59:47
列表的添加
1)+ 添加
2)append 追加
一次只能添加一个元素到列表中,适合用于循环里
3)extend 拉伸
可一次添加多个元素到列表中
4)insert 插入
append与extend都是添加在最后,insert可以插入在指定位置
命令 | 作用 |
---|---|
service.insert(n,’ ') | 将’'中的内容,插入到第n个之后 |
service.insert(1,‘samba’) | 将samba插入到第一个之后 |
练习:
插入到第三个之后
插入到第二个后
插入两个
本结果表明:firewalld是在samba之后。因为samba插入到第一个之后,就变为了第二个;此时将firewalld插入到第二个后,就在samba之后了。
在列表指定位置添加元素
Python也提供了insert()方法,可以在列表任意指定位置插入元素,其基本语法为:
source_list.insert(index,obj)其中
source_list
:为待修改的列表index
:为待插入的位置索引obj
:为待插入的元素
注意:在Python中,列表起始元素的位置索引为0例如,要向guests列表中Zhang san的后面增加客人Hu qi,则相应的语句为:
# 创建并初始化guests列表
guests=['Zhang san','Li si','Wang wu','Zhao liu']
# 向guests列表Zhang san后面增加一个名为Hu qi的客人
guests.insert(1,'Hu qi')
# 输出新的guests列表
print(guests)
输出结果为:
['Zhang san','Hu qi','Li si','Wang wu','Zhao liu']
来源:https://blog.csdn.net/ly_qiu/article/details/106359717
标签:python,列表,添加
![](/images/zang.png)
![](/images/jiucuo.png)
猜你喜欢
fckeditor 常用函数
2023-01-25 15:47:11
vue实现手机号码的校验实例代码(防抖函数的应用场景)
2024-05-29 22:19:44
![](https://img.aspxhome.com/file/2023/2/123182_0s.png)
Windows系统彻底卸载SQL Server通用方法(推荐!)
2024-01-17 19:03:25
![](https://img.aspxhome.com/file/2023/1/98071_0s.jpg)
Pytorch可视化之Visdom使用实例
2021-01-05 12:16:13
![](https://img.aspxhome.com/file/2023/5/121015_0s.jpg)
Python使用ConfigParser模块操作配置文件的方法
2023-09-05 18:38:18
python配置文件写入过程详解
2021-02-06 01:46:19
基于鼠标点击跟踪的用户点击行为分析
2008-04-24 19:22:00
MYSQL之on和where的区别解读
2024-01-21 20:17:46
![](https://img.aspxhome.com/file/2023/2/66612_0s.png)
Django 限制用户访问频率的中间件的实现
2023-12-17 20:19:19
利用python绘制中国地图(含省界、河流等)
2021-12-19 03:19:59
![](https://img.aspxhome.com/file/2023/9/128209_0s.jpg)
如何解决SQLServer占内存过多的问题
2008-12-18 15:01:00
Java API学习教程之正则表达式详解
2023-10-23 05:28:21
![](https://img.aspxhome.com/file/2023/2/65352_0s.png)
Python 3.x踩坑实战汇总
2021-04-21 12:25:47
js中将多个语句写成一个语句的两种方法小结
2024-04-28 09:48:42
PHP加密函数 Javascript/Js 解密函数
2023-06-15 18:03:03
CentOS下安装python3.5+scrapy的方法步骤
2022-07-17 20:01:42
Python实现的序列化和反序列化二叉树算法示例
2021-06-11 07:14:23
JS弹出窗口插件zDialog简单用法示例
2024-05-22 10:32:18
Python ttkbootstrap 制作账户注册信息界面的案例代码
2021-02-10 04:05:11
![](https://img.aspxhome.com/file/2023/6/124396_0s.png)
三行Python代码提高数据处理脚本速度
2021-10-15 22:56:54
![](https://img.aspxhome.com/file/2023/3/90533_0s.png)